Multipoint pairing AONIC 50 headphones support Bluetooth multipoint pairing which enables the headphones to be connected to two devices at the same time. AONIC 50 will remain connected to both devices and receive inputs alternately.

    Shure Incorporated Using the Buttons Power button Power on Press and hold, 2 seconds Power off Press and hold, 2 seconds Turn off the headphones Pair Bluetooth Press and hold, 6 seconds Check battery status Double press (audible status notification)

Environment mode Environment mode allows you to accentuate the ambient noise around you. This is especially useful when you want to listen to music or are on a phone call, yet you still want to be aware of the sounds around you.

    Shure Incorporated Adjusting EQ Select and adjust frequency, gain, and bandwidth in the equalizer. Equalization Explained The 4-band parametric equalizer is used to adjust the volume of independent, adjustable frequency ranges, to precisely shape the frequency response. The equalizer can be bypassed for a flat frequency response.

  • Page 14 Shure Incorporated Driver Size 50 mm Frequency Response 20 to 22,000 Hz Sensitivity @ 1 kHz 97.5 dB/mW Impedance @ 1 kHz 39 Ω Maximum Input Power 100 mW Weight 334 g (11.8oz.) Operating Temperature 0°C to 45°C (32°F to 113°F) Storage Temperature -10°C to 45°C (14°F to 113°F)
